本文将探究开鲁县H5小程序高级流程,通过对开发工作的规划、流程和注意事项进行详细分析,来提升开发效率。文章将分为五个部分,包括规划阶段、设计阶段、开发阶段、测试阶段和上线阶段。通过本文的学习,读者可以更好地掌握H5小程序的开发流程,提高工作效率和成果质量。
1、规划阶段
在规划阶段,我们需要明确开发目标和步骤,合理安排进度和资源,制定开发计划和策略。首先,我们需要明确小程序的功能和设计要求,以及用户需求和客户期望,依次分解出不同的任务和子任务,并确定优先级和时间节点。然后,我们需要通读H5小程序的文档和教程,了解技术规范和开发流程,熟悉工具和组件的使用方法,做好项目结构和代码架构的设计。最后,我们需要评估项目风险和挑战,考虑备份和恢复策略,以及如何维护和更新小程序后续版本。
2、设计阶段
在设计阶段,我们需要完成小程序的前端设计和用户交互,制定UI和UE规范,以及编写必要的配套文档和说明。首先,我们需要了解小程序的设计原则和规范,选择适合项目的UI框架和组件,设计和排版页面布局、配色和字体等,带有用户体验的借口设计与制作,注意到用户人群和场景,确保小程序的易用性和美观性。然后,我们需要编写UI和UE文档,包括设计理念、样式规范、UI组件库和UE流程图等,方便后期维护和揭示实现。最后,我们需要与开发团队密切合作,以确保设计方案的可行性和完整性。
3、开发阶段
在开发阶段,我们需要实现小程序的核心功能和技术模块,编写和调试代码,测试和优化性能。首先,我们需要根据设计方案和要求编写前端代码,使用HTML、CSS、JS等技术语言实现各种功能。然后,我们需要完成数据的交互和处理,与后端服务器进行数据通信和协议集成,使用小程序提供的API完成各类操作和功能。最后,我们需要测试和调试代码,确保小程序的兼容性和性能优化,保证代码逻辑清晰,代码规范,避免程序中出现严重性问题和难以调试的错误。
4、测试阶段
在测试阶段,我们需要对小程序进行全面的测试和评估,发现和修复各类缺陷和漏洞,优化用户体验和功能性能。首先,我们需要进行需求测试和验收测试,确保小程序的功能和规范符合设计要求和用户期望。然后,我们需要进行横向和纵向测试,包括功能测试、兼容性测试、性能测试、安全测试等,重点测试方案中的关键步骤和难点。最后,我们需要对测试结果进行分类和分析,发现和记录各类异常和问题,编写测试报告和修复计划,确保小程序符合质量标准和要求。
5、上线阶段
在上线阶段,我们需要将小程序部署到线上服务器,并进行配套和监控工作,确保小程序的稳定性和可用性。首先,我们需要将小程序打包成发布版,并上传到服务器,使用微信小程序开发工具构建和支持,发布到线上正式环境。然后,我们需要对小程序进行巡视和监测,及时发现和解决各类异常和错误。最后,我们需要进行用户反馈调查和接收用户建议,进行相关产品优化和升级,以不断满足用户需求和提高用户体验。
在本文中,我们详细介绍了开鲁县H5小程序高级流程,并分别阐述了不同阶段需要注意的问题和注意事项。通过这些步骤的规划和执行,我们可以更好地提高开发效率和成果质量,满足用户需求和客户期望。同时,我们也需要不断学习和更新技术,了解市场和竞争环境,不断加强自身的实践能力和技术水平。希望本文对小程序开发者有所帮助,欢迎大家提出宝贵的意见和建议。
本文将介绍开鲁县H5小程序的高级流程,主要包括项目初始化、页面开发、模块封装、API调用和上线发布等方面,并且结合实际案例,分析如何提高开发效率。通过学习本文,您将对H5小程序开发有更加深入的理解,从而让项目开发更加高效、顺畅,为用户提供更好的体验。
1. 项目初始化流程
在开发H5小程序之前,需要进行项目初始化,这包括创建项目、配置项目、安装依赖等操作。
1.1 创建项目
使用HBuilder X工具可快速创建H5小程序项目,通过点击File->New->H5 Hybrid App,选择小程序类型并输入项目名称即可。
1.2 配置项目
在创建项目后,需要根据项目需求进行相关配置,例如设置目录结构、选择开发框架、配置服务器等。
1.3 安装依赖
通过npm工具可以安装相关依赖,例如Vue.js、Vuex等插件,从而实现更加高效的开发。
2. 页面开发流程
在进行页面开发时,可以使用Vue.js等框架实现组件化开发,从而提高开发效率。
2.1 组件化开发
在Vue.js中,可以将每个页面视为一个独立的组件,并通过props属性实现数据传递。这样可以方便地复用组件,提高开发效率。
2.2 模板渲染
通过使用Vue.js中的模板渲染语法,可以快速地实现页面布局和样式设置,从而节约开发时间。
3. 模块封装流程
在开发过程中,有时需要封装一些通用模块,例如请求接口、数据存储等,从而提高代码复用率。
3.1 封装API接口
通过封装API接口,可以实现对接口的统一管理,避免重复代码,并且方便后期修改和维护。
3.2 封装存储模块
通过封装存储模块,可以实现统一的数据管理,例如用户信息、地址信息等,从而简化代码逻辑,提高代码可读性。
4. API调用流程
在进行API调用时,需要注意数据加密和安全性等问题,并且通过封装API接口,实现统一管理,从而保障数据的稳定性和可靠性。
4.1 数据加密
通过使用HTTPS协议和私钥等方式,可以保障数据加密处理,防止数据泄露和攻击。
4.2 API管理
通过统一管理API接口,可以方便后期的接口维护和修改,并且提高代码复用率,简化开发流程。
5. 上线发布流程
在完成开发之后,需要进行上线发布,这包括测试、发布、监控等操作。
5.1 测试
在发布之前,需要进行测试,包括功能测试、兼容性测试、性能测试等,从而保障小程序质量。
5.2 发布
通过使用HBuilder X中的发布功能,可以简单方便地进行上线发布,从而让小程序正式上线。
5.3 监控
在小程序上线之后,需要进行监控,包括访问量统计、性能分析、错误监控等,从而及时发现问题并进行处理。
通过本文的介绍,我们了解了开鲁县H5小程序的高级流程以及如何提高开发效率。在开发过程中,我们需要注重代码优化和数据安全等方面,从而保障小程序的质量和稳定性。期待能够帮助读者更好地进行H5小程序的开发。